Parameter Definitions

Unless otherwise noted, the following table of parameter definitions
applies to all supported remote commands. Commands that have [ ]
around them are optional. For example, [SOURce] is not required
for the SOURCE subsystem.

Table 8- Parameter Definitions

Parameter

Description

<Boolean>

“ON” or “1”, “OFF” or 0

<NR1>

Data format for integers. Zero, positive, and

negative integer numeric values are valid data.

<NRf>

Data format for floating numeric representation.

Zero, positive, and negative floating point numeric

values are all valid data.

<LF>

Line feed character (0x0A) used for termination of

a string

<CR>

Carriage return character (0x0D))used for

termination of a string

<SP>

Space character

Remote Commands

All commands are terminated with both a <CR> and <LF>or just
<LF>character. For example, to query the instrument’s ID, this
command is sent:

*IDN?<CR><LF>

*IDN?<LF>


Commands sent without correct termination will return an error
and/or will not have a response.
